Sizing up is also a good idea if you're planning to use glove liners (i. e. a thin additional inner glove), which can be a good option for particularly cold weather, or for riders who really struggle to keep their hands warm. It consists of three layers: a merino wool inner layer, a hydrophilic waterproof membrane, and a durable goatskin with soft-shell outer layer. On test we found them one of the best winter cycling glove to happily withstand a light shower or drizzle no problem, but as we've said with the likes of the Assos Assosoires Winter Gloves and the Rapha Pro Team Winter Gloves, this style of microfibre it will always get wet, so it's a matter of when not if.
